After 56 days of deadlock, the protracted doctors' strike reached a resolution as the government and the Kenya Medical Practitioners, Pharmacists and Dentists Union (KMPDU) inked a return-to-work agreement on Wednesday, May 8, 2024.

E-citizen director General Isaac Ochieng has dismissed claims by auditor General Nancy Gathungu that the state has little control over the e-citizen self-service payment portal. According to Ochieng, the private individuals claimed to be in control of the system have since been contracted to maintain it and that it is the government that is now in charge.

A humanitarian crisis is looming in Ahero, Kisumu county after floods rendered most families homeless with roads converted to lakes. Government spokesperson Isaac Mwaura says the overflowing of river Nyando has heavily impacted the river Nyando bridge with the Nairobi - Kisii - Homabay highway becoming impassable..already 238 have died from the heavy downpour.

The 11 member select committee probing the impeachment grounds for removal of agriculture cabinet secretary Mithika Linturi from office is now entering a crucial stage in the next two days as both parties will submit before parliament. This comes even as the sponsor of the motion, Jack Wamboka, is urging the international community to cease and desist working with Linturi and even deny him a travel visa. At the same time Meru leaders led by Deputy Governor Isaac Mutuma are pleading with President William Ruto to intervene and save Linturi from being impeached.

The government has promised to foot all medical expenses of families who lost their loved ones in the Mai Mahiu flood tragedy. While this marks the 9th day since the start of rescue operations, at least 30 families are still waiting to find their missing kin even as the government has been called upon to fast truck measures to mitigate the effects of the raging floods.
